- These proceedings were listed for hearing before me for three days on Monday 18 August 2008. The plaintiff called all its witnesses. On the afternoon of the third day of the hearing, as cross-examination of the last of the plaintiff's witnesses drew to a close, counsel for the plaintiff made an application to read and rely upon further affidavit evidence in chief, from Mr Stefano Canturi, a director of the plaintiff. The matter was stood over to the following day and, when further amendments to Mr Canturi's affidavit were foreshadowed, to Friday 22 August 2008.
- Mr Canturi's revised affidavit was served on Friday afternoon. It is 25 pages long and comes with a large folder of annexures, all of which are documents not seen before by the defendant. Counsel for the defendant then informed the court that he intended to oppose the application of the plaintiff to read and rely upon this further affidavit evidence in chief. The plaintiff's contested application was argued on 25 August 2008.
